Citizenship, via financial investment. Currently, as of March 15, 2022, the amount of investment is $800,000 (in Targeted Work Areas and Backwoods) and $1,050,000 in other places (non-TEA areas). Congress has accepted these quantities for the following five years beginning March 15, 2022.
To get the EB-5 Visa, Capitalists should create 10 full time U.S. jobs within two years from the day of their complete investment. EB5 Investment Immigration. This EB-5 Visa Demand makes sure that investments contribute straight to the united state task market. This applies whether the jobs are created straight by the company or indirectly under sponsorship of a designated EB-5 Regional Facility like EB5 United

These tasks are established through versions that use inputs such as development expenses (e.g., construction and equipment costs) or annual earnings created by recurring procedures. On the other hand, under the standalone, or direct, EB-5 Program, only straight, full time W-2 employee positions within the company may be counted. An essential threat of relying exclusively on direct staff members is that personnel decreases because of market problems could lead to insufficient permanent placements, potentially bring about USCIS rejection of the capitalist's request if the task creation requirement is not satisfied.

The financial design after that projects the variety of straight jobs the brand-new service is likely to produce based on its expected profits. Indirect tasks determined through economic versions describes work produced in sectors that provide the items or solutions to business straight entailed in the project. These work are created as a result of the increased need for items, materials, or services that support the organization's operations.

An employment-based fifth choice group (EB-5) financial investment visa offers an approach of coming to be a long-term united state homeowner for international nationals wishing to spend capital in the USA. In order to obtain this permit, a foreign capitalist should invest $1.8 million (or $900,000 in a Regional Center within a "Targeted Work Location") and develop or maintain at the very least 10 full time jobs for USA employees (leaving out the capitalist and their instant household).

This step has actually been a significant success. Today, 95% of all EB-5 capital is increased and spent by Regional Centers. Because the 2008 monetary crisis, accessibility to resources has been restricted and local budget plans remain to deal with significant deficiencies. In numerous areas, EB-5 investments have actually filled up the financing gap, giving a brand-new, important source of funding for neighborhood economic advancement jobs that rejuvenate neighborhoods, create and support tasks, framework, and services.

Here are the basic actions to obtaining an EB-5 capitalist permit: The initial step is to find a qualifying financial investment possibility. This can be a new commercial venture, a local center task, or an existing business that will be visit the site expanded or restructured.
When the possibility has been identified, the investor must make the financial investment and send an I-526 application to the U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S). This request must include proof of the investment, such as financial institution declarations, purchase agreements, and company plans. The USCIS will review the I-526 request and either accept it or request extra proof.
